Bu nedenle, i\u015fletmeniz i\u00e7in havay\u0131 temizlemeniz gerekti\u011finde ya\u011fs\u0131z bir kompres\u00f6r se\u00e7melisiniz.<\/p>\n<h2>Tek a\u015famal\u0131<\/h2>\n<p>Tek kademeli hava kompres\u00f6r\u00fc, di\u011fer ad\u0131yla pistonlu hava kompres\u00f6r\u00fc, havay\u0131 yaln\u0131zca bir kez s\u0131k\u0131\u015ft\u0131r\u0131p bir silindirde depolar. Depolanan bu hava, tornavida, keski ve anahtar gibi \u00e7e\u015fitli pn\u00f6matik ekipmanlara g\u00fc\u00e7 sa\u011flayacak kadar enerjiye sahiptir. Bu \u00fcniteler ayr\u0131ca d\u00fc\u015f\u00fck ak\u0131\u015fl\u0131 uygulamalar i\u00e7in de idealdir ve benzin istasyonlar\u0131nda, oto tamirhanelerinde ve \u00e7e\u015fitli \u00fcretim tesislerinde yayg\u0131n olarak kullan\u0131l\u0131r.<br \/>Tek kademeli bir hava kompres\u00f6r\u00fc, s\u0131k\u0131\u015ft\u0131r\u0131lm\u0131\u015f havay\u0131 iletmek i\u00e7in iki valf kullan\u0131r; biri giri\u015f, di\u011feri \u00e7\u0131k\u0131\u015f i\u00e7indir. \u0130ki valf de yaylar taraf\u0131ndan \u00e7al\u0131\u015ft\u0131r\u0131l\u0131r. Giri\u015f valfi, hasara kar\u015f\u0131 g\u00fcvenlik sa\u011flamak i\u00e7in hafif bir e\u011fime sahiptir. Kompres\u00f6r\u00fcn \u00e7\u0131k\u0131\u015f valfi, silindirdeki bas\u0131n\u00e7 depolama tank\u0131ndaki bas\u0131n\u00e7tan daha y\u00fcksek oldu\u011funda a\u00e7\u0131l\u0131r. Piston, s\u0131k\u0131\u015ft\u0131rma i\u015flemi s\u0131ras\u0131nda \u00f6nemli miktarda kuvvet uygulayarak silindir i\u00e7inde \u00e7ok h\u0131zl\u0131 hareket eder. Bu y\u00fcksek piston h\u0131z\u0131, kompres\u00f6r a\u015f\u0131nmas\u0131n\u0131n ve y\u0131pranmas\u0131n\u0131n s\u0131k g\u00f6r\u00fclen bir nedenidir.<br \/>Tek fazl\u0131 hava kompres\u00f6r\u00fc, k\u00fc\u00e7\u00fck \u00f6l\u00e7ekli i\u015fletmeler ve in\u015faat ekipleri i\u00e7in en uygunudur.
